Kloudifold wrote:
> sm750 driver has sm750_hw_cursor_* functions, which are named in
> camelcase. Rename them to snake case to follow the function naming
> convention.
> 
> - sm750_hw_cursor_setSize  => sm750_hw_cursor_set_size
> - sm750_hw_cursor_setPos   => sm750_hw_cursor_set_pos
> - sm750_hw_cursor_setColor => sm750_hw_cursor_set_color
> - sm750_hw_cursor_setData  => sm750_hw_cursor_set_data
> - sm750_hw_cursor_setData2 => sm750_hw_cursor_set_data2

I think this is fine.

But I would like to see a follow up patch to just remove
sm750_hw_cursor_set_data2().  It is not called anywhere.

11:43:22 > git grep sm750_hw_cursor_setData2
drivers/staging/sm750fb/sm750_cursor.c:void sm750_hw_cursor_setData2(struct lynx_cursor *cursor, u16 rop,
drivers/staging/sm750fb/sm750_cursor.h:void sm750_hw_cursor_setData2(struct lynx_cursor *cursor, u16 rop,

That said:

Reviewed-by: Ira Weiny <ira.weiny@intel.com>
